Moorhouse Road is in London and in City Of Westminster district. W2 5DH is located in the Bayswater electoral ward, within the English Parliamentary constituency of Westminster North. This postcode has been in use since 1980-01-01.

People

Gender

In the UK, the overall gender distribution is approximately 49% male and 51% female. The area surrounding W2 5DH has a slightly higher male population, with 52.7% of residents being male. Several factors can contribute to this, including areas with industries or sectors that predominantly employ men, proximity to universities or technical schools with a higher enrollment of male students, presence of all-male or predominantly male institutions (military academies, boarding schools).

Partnership Status

Across the UK, the average relationship status breakdown is roughly 44% married, 38% single, 9% divorced, 6% widowed, and 2% separated.

In the immediate area around W2 5DH, a significant portion of the population is single, making up 49.2% of the residents. On average, approximately 38% of individuals who responded to the census in the UK were single. Areas with higher single populations are typically urban centers, university towns, regions with dynamic job markets, rich cultural offerings and entertainment facilities. These regions also tend to have a younger demographic.

Safety

Is Moorhouse Road dangerous?

Over the last 12 months, the overall crime rate around Moorhouse Road was 219.2 per 1,000 residents, which is 7.4% higher than the Bayswater average. The most reported crime type was Anti-social behaviour.

Moorhouse Road has the 28th highest crime rate of 56 local areas in Bayswater and the 267th highest crime rate of 587 local areas in Westminster .

Violent and sexual offences accounted for around 26.9 crimes per 1,000 residents and have been rising year on year. Over the last decade, overall crime has fallen by about -48.6%.

Employment

W2 5DH area has a very high level of entrepreneurship. Only 1% of streets have higher percent of entrepreneur residents. 21% of population in this area is self-employed, while the average in the UK is 9.7%. High number of entrepreneurs usually leads to relatively high economic growth, higher paid jobs and better quality of life in the area.
